What is International Health Coverage Insurance?
International health coverage insurance provides medical protection for individuals outside their home country. Unlike standard travel insurance, which often covers short-term emergencies, international health insurance caters to long-term needs, including routine check-ups, specialist treatments, and chronic conditions.
Why is it Essential?
Healthcare systems vary significantly across countries, and without appropriate coverage, you could face exorbitant medical bills. International health coverage insurance ensures access to quality healthcare anywhere in the world, minimizing out-of-pocket expenses.
Types of International Health Coverage Insurance
There are several types of international health insurance plans available, each designed to meet different needs and preferences. Understanding these can help you make an informed decision.
Individual Plans
These plans are tailored for solo travelers or expatriates. They offer flexibility in choosing healthcare providers and cater to personal medical requirements.
Family Plans
Family plans provide coverage for you, your spouse, and your children. They often include maternity care and pediatric services, ensuring comprehensive protection for your entire family.
Corporate Plans
Many companies offer international health coverage insurance as employee benefits. These plans are designed to ensure global employees receive the healthcare they need, fostering productivity and satisfaction.
Key Features to Consider
When choosing international health coverage insurance, it’s important to consider several key features to ensure the plan meets your needs.
Coverage Limits
Look for a policy with adequate coverage limits. Some plans may cap the maximum amount they pay for medical care, which could leave you exposed to financial risks.
Network of Providers
A broad network of hospitals and doctors ensures you can access top-quality healthcare wherever you are. Check whether your desired healthcare facilities are included.
Emergency Evacuation
This feature covers the cost of transportation to the nearest suitable medical facility in the event of a serious illness or injury, which is often necessary when traveling in remote areas.
Deductibles and Copayments
Understand the deductibles and copayments associated with the plan. Lower deductibles often mean higher premiums, so consider what balance works best for you.
